
RAG CLI
producthunt.com
本地优先的RAG命令行工具
昨天制作者:Vương Trương Ngọc
关于 RAG CLI
RAG CLI 是一款本地优先的检索增强生成(RAG)命令行工具,专为个人文档管理设计。它能够索引 Markdown、纯文本和 PDF 文件,并通过本地嵌入模型和 Upstash Vector DB 提供语义搜索功能,让您无需依赖云端服务即可高效检索本地知识库。
核心功能
- 本地嵌入与向量存储:使用本地嵌入模型生成文档向量,并存储于 Upstash Vector DB,确保数据隐私与低延迟。
- 多格式支持:支持索引 Markdown、文本和 PDF 文件,覆盖日常文档需求。
- 语义搜索:基于向量相似度进行语义搜索,而非简单关键词匹配,结果更精准。
- 命令行界面:轻量级 CLI 工具,适合开发者集成到工作流中。
主要特性
- 隐私优先:所有数据处理均在本地完成,无需上传至云端。
- 高效索引:快速扫描并索引指定目录下的文档,增量更新。
- 可定制嵌入:支持自定义嵌入模型,适应不同领域需求。
- 无缝集成:可与其他 CLI 工具或脚本结合,自动化文档检索流程。
适用场景
- 个人知识管理:快速检索笔记、技术文档等本地文件。
- 开发者工具链:集成到开发环境,实现代码文档的智能搜索。
- 离线环境:在无网络或受限网络环境下使用语义搜索。